ID3DXEffect::EndParameterBlock

Stop capturing effect parameter state changes.

D3DXHANDLE EndParameterBlock();

Parameters

None.

Return Values

Returns a handle to the parameter state block.

Remarks

All effect parameters that change state (after calling BeginParameterBlock and before calling EndParameterBlock) will be saved in an effect parameter state block. Use ApplyParameterBlock to apply this block of state changes to the effect system. Once you are finished with a state block use DeleteParameterBlock to free the memory.

Requirements

Header: Declared in D3dx9effect.h.

See Also

ID3DXEffect::BeginParameterBlock, ID3DXEffect::ApplyParameterBlock, ID3DXEffect::DeleteParameterBlock